Output ec3807390e2f13b4fcb4b0a33f76b51bf4f8ac936bdc71073fa0dd2a60d1ae9b:0

value
1566086
script pubkey
OP_0 OP_PUSHBYTES_20 fafccc3ba71300d95eae610c436a8bb37b0cfb4a
address
bc1qlt7vcwa8zvqdjh4wvyxyx65tkdase762urddt9
transaction
ec3807390e2f13b4fcb4b0a33f76b51bf4f8ac936bdc71073fa0dd2a60d1ae9b
confirmations
183668
spent
true